Liverpool fullback Johnson: No tears for Balotelli departure

Liverpool fullback Glen Johnson has taken a swipe at former Manchester City striker Mario Balotelli. Johnson faces City today in the first match since Balo was flogged to AC Milan.

Some City fans may wish the Italian had stayed put.

But England star Johnson said: "I don't think they will miss Balotelli. I'm not being disrespectful to the guy but everyone knows what he's like.

"On his day, he can be a great player... but City have got great players who do it a lot more often and score more goals than him."

Johnson, 28, also faced Balo in England's Euro 2012 quarter-final against Italy.

And the Anfield defender added: "We all have our faults but Mario let his side down a lot with silly red cards and stuff like that.

"He's a great player but we didn't see that enough. Personally, I won't miss him. He was probably more famous for things he did off the pitch than what he did on it."
